1. Managing horses in groups to improve horse welfare and human safety : reactions to mixing and separation
Sammanfattning : The aim of this thesis was to investigate whether specific anecdotal concerns related to keeping horses in groups are supported by science and, if so, provide scientifically based recommendations that could be implemented in practice. The aim of studies I and II was to identify methods for mixing unfamiliar horses that could minimise aggressive interactions and associated risk of injury. LÄS MER

3. Metabolic regulation in developing barley seeds : novel insights from transcriptome analyses
Sammanfattning : The barley (Hordeum vulgare) seed, termed caryopsis, is of high importance for feed and food industry. In addition, it provides an excellent model to study the development and physiology of starch-storing cereal seeds. Gene expression in caryopses, like all plant organs, is to a large extent regulated by the cellular sugar status. LÄS MER
4. The Forgotten : an Approach on Harappan Toy Artefacts
Sammanfattning : This thesis proposes an alternative perspective to the general neglect of toy materials from deeper analysis in archaeology. Based on a study of selected toy artefacts from the Classical Harappan settlement at Bagasra, Gujarat, it suggests a viable way of approaching the objects when considering them within a theoretical framework highlighting their social aspects.
